About This Course

Welcome to "Best Methods and Know-How's for Architecture: 2025"! This course dives deep into cutting-edge approaches and essential knowledge shaping the future of architectural design.

We'll explore everything from theoretical foundations to practical applications, focusing on how innovative methodologies and technologies are transforming the field. Specifically, we'll examine how design addresses current challenges, generates creative solutions, and enriches user experiences across various disciplines.

Our journey begins by laying a solid foundation in design methods and creativity:

  • Foundations of Design and the Creative Process: Understand design as a problem-solving journey, emphasizing idea generation and exploration.
  • Oxymoron as a Creative Design Method: Discover how merging contradictory concepts sparks innovative solutions across architectural, industrial, and graphic design, with practical applications like the Gümüşhane Pier Square case study.
  • Critical Approaches to Architectural Texts: Explore intellectual, theoretical, and critical practices in architectural discourse. Use content analysis (quantitative, qualitative, mixed-methods, and AI-assisted) to understand themes and evolution in architectural literature.
  • Contextual Design Practices: Analyze the interplay between buildings and their social, cultural, and environmental contexts through the Gümüşhane Cultural Center, highlighting Nevzat Sayın's design philosophy and the impact of subsequent alterations.
  • Energy Efficiency in Architectural Design: Learn about the construction sector's energy impact, climate-compatible systems, advanced façade technologies (such as the Turkish Contractors’ Association Headquarters and Unilever Haus), and the lessons from historical buildings like the Harput Grand Mosque.
  • Accessibility in Urban Planning: Address the critical need for inclusive design in urban open spaces, focusing on mobility barriers and creating accessible environments for all, exemplified by a detailed case study of Çanakkale Onsekiz Mart University.
  • Abstract Art and Furniture Design: Investigate the historical evolution of art and its profound influence on furniture design, exploring how movements like Suprematism (Malevich, Mondrian) translate into three-dimensional forms.
  • Visualizing Complex Urban Concepts with Generative AI: Utilize AI to represent fictional cities, demonstrating its potential to accelerate design processes and enhance creativity through detailed parameterization and iterative refinement, using Italo Calvino's Armilla City as a case study.
  • Designing Child-Friendly Urban Open Spaces: Understand the vital role of urban spaces in children's holistic development, focusing on age-specific needs, safety, accessibility, and integration with nature.

This course will equip you with the knowledge and skills to navigate and shape the architectural landscape of 2025 and beyond.
